dc.description We extend the instanton calculus for N = 1/2 U(2) supersymmetric gauge theory by including one massless flavor. We write the equations of motion at leading order in the coupling constant and we solve them exactly in the non(anti)commutativity parameter C. The profile of the matter superfield is deformed through linear and quadratic corrections in C. Higher order corrections are absent because of the fermionic nature of the back-reaction. The instanton effective action, in addition to the usual 't Hooft term, includes a contribution of order C <sup>2</sup> and is N = 1/2 invariant. We argue that the N = 1 result for the gluino condensate is not modified by the presence of the new term in the effective action.
